Why Outfit Inspiration Matters for Fashion Video Creators

Fashion is one of the most-watched verticals on T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ts, but audience attention is brutal. Viewers scroll past generic styling clips in under a second. What stops the scroll is a fresh concept, a bold aesthetic, or a relatable twist on a trend. Outfit inspiration is not just about pretty clothes; it is the creative spark that gives every video a hook, a story, and a reason to rewatch.

  • Algorithm love: Videos with high watch-time and save rates get pushed harder. Unique outfit concepts extend watch-time because viewers want to see the final reveal.Audience identity: Followers return to creators who match their personal style or aspire to a version of themselves they see in your videos.Brand deals: Sponsors notice creators whose looks feel editorial, on-trend, and ready for product placement.

Where to Find Fresh Outfit Inspiration for Creators

The best creators treat inspiration like a daily habit. Here are five reliable sources that keep content flowing.

1. Pinterest Mood Boards

Build private boards around themes like "Y2K Office Core" or "Coastal Grandmother Fall." Pinterest's algorithm surfaces adjacent styles fast, giving you a rolling feed of niche aesthetics to remix.

2. Runway and Editorial Lookbooks

Design houses release seasonal lookbooks months before trends hit fast fashion. Pull three to four silhouettes from each show and translate them into high-street pieces your audience can actually buy.

3. Street Style and Archive Fashion Accounts

Instagram and TikTok are packed with archivists posting rare vintage finds. Follow them, screenshot what speaks to you, and remix eras in unexpected pairings (think 90s slip dress over 80s tailoring).

3. Music and Pop Culture Moments

New album drops, movie releases, and viral TV moments create instant outfit demand. Tie your styling choices to cultural moments to ride trending sounds and hashtags.

How to Turn Outfit Inspiration Into Viral Short-Form Videos

Inspiration is useless without execution. Use this framework to convert ideas into high-performing posts.

Pick One Strong Concept Per Video

Avoid the "outfit of the week" overload. Instead, commit to one clear idea per clip: "5 ways to style a trench coat," "Three outfits under $50," or "What I wore on a first date." A single promise keeps retention high.

Lead With a Hook in the First 1.5 Seconds

Open with a bold visual or a question. Examples: "This $12 thrift find looks designer," "Stop wearing basics this fall," or "The outfit that got me 50 brand deals." Pair it with the most striking frame of your look.

Use Strategic Transitions

Transitions are the heartbeat of outfit content. Try the hand-on-lens reveal, mirror spin, or the before-after split. OutfitVideo's AI suggests transition patterns matched to your chosen aesthetic, so you never run out of fresh movement ideas.

Match the Platform's Style

  • TikTok: Fast pacing, trending sounds, raw authenticity, text-on-screen.Instagram Reels: Polished lighting, aesthetic grids, music from emerging artists.YouTube Shorts: Slightly longer storytelling, voiceover-friendly, SEO-friendly captions.

End With a Call to Action

Ask viewers to comment their favorite look, save the video for later, or share it with a friend who needs styling help. Saves and shares are the two strongest signals for algorithmic reach.

Smart Strategies to Scale Your Content Calendar

Posting daily is the gold standard, but burnout is real. Build a sustainable system.
